Output 4a5e71c3143230e36aecbb65405633b61b2502873ce94c624ec2667b8936311a:16

value
44458
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e462e42de4b9ff825a6a65db7738eaec9c23bbbc OP_EQUAL
address
3NWcTNTigJ1hLFTQuxB9LEV7LwzDg1WmCY
transaction
4a5e71c3143230e36aecbb65405633b61b2502873ce94c624ec2667b8936311a
confirmations
257015
spent
true